Exploring the New Breed of Home Designs

With features including outdoor entertaining areas, walk-in pantries, guest bedrooms and even lifts, the new breed of Hometown Australia homes deliver comfortable and modern living.

Downsizing.com.au spoke to Hometown Australia’s long-time National Development Manager Michael Grosvenor to discuss recent changes to over 50s lifestyle community homes. Mr Grosvenor said that, over the past seven years, he’s seen Hometown Australia’s new homes deliver a plethora of additional and strengthened features in response to consumer demand.

“These days consumers are looking for that more traditional style home built on site rather than the factory-built home you may have seen brought into these communities in the past,” said Mr Grosvenor.

Hometown Australia has responded to consumer demand by introducing home design features including:

• Dual parking, including recreational vehicle parking if possible and enclosed garages.

• Step-free access to the home, wider hallways and plenty of space to move about in the main bathroom and bedroom.

• Spacious, covered alfresco entertaining areas relating to indoor/outdoor entertaining.

• Solar panels, to reduce the cost of power.

• Multi-purpose rooms, which could be used as studies if people are still working, or for hobbies or a guest room for friends or grandchildren when visiting.

• Second bathrooms, many with clever two-way access options providing a “second” ensuite.

• Custom options, including butler’s pantries and extra parking spots.

• Options of two-level living to capture views whilst retaining ease of access via an internal lift.

“In the seven years I’ve been in the industry, I’ve seen massive changes in home designs. Much of it has come down to the fact that we are accommodating to the market of over 50s who aren’t necessarily retired but are working, semi-retired or planning for future retirement. Home designs offer double space garages, multi-purpose rooms that can be utilised as a home office and spaces where you can entertain and enjoy life. In addition, people are looking for quality homes which are architecturally and aesthetically pleasing than what you may have seen in the past,” said Mr Grosvenor.

About the Land Lease Living Model

All the above homes are available under Hometown Australia’s innovative land lease model, where residents own their dwellings and then secure a long-term lease on the land on which it stands. This model has significant benefits, including allowing residents to avoid paying stamp duty or council rates, while also having the potential for eligible homeowners to claim Commonwealth Rental Assistance.
